Here's who to watch tonight Wednesday 31st July (PM) to Thursday 1st August (AM) AEST



The Aussie women have dominated in the pool again overnight, with Kaylee McKeown securing gold and beating her own exisiting record in the 100m BackstrokeđŸ„‡


Meanwhile, Tara Rigney is into the semi- finals of the single sculls for rowing and it was heartbreak for our Aussie Sevens girls who went down 14-12 to the USA in the Bronze Medal match, fighting hard until the final whistle.


Plus many more amazing feats across the many sporting codes, but for now, onto the next day ....
